Thursday night soup: onions, carrots, parsnips, potatoes, yellow-eyed peas, roman beans, parsley, lavender, dried garlic chips, salt and pepper

Shabbat soup: leftovers of the above with the addition of a couple of chicken thighs
turkey meatloaf: ground turkey, gluten-free oat bread crumbs (from the last time the Imperfects were over), dried garlic chips, ketchup, hot sauce, brown miso paste
roasted green beans (these were snacked upon earlier today)
baked sweet potatoes
pickled red onions
chicken thighs baked with the last of the boozy apricots plus ginger spread
green salad if I get inspired
apple slices baked with ground walnutsl and Lyle's golden syrup

Brought to my hosts' for lunch: green leaf lettuce, hearts of palm, and pink grapefruit sections for a salad.

(Why, yes, it is use-up-open-containers-in-the-fridge time. :-)
